A mattress is often laid over a palang for additional comfort, as seen in this example. Placed in the verandah of the house, this palang was used to sit on or take a nap during the day by the eldest lady in the house. This is one of the few examples in which a footboard was an additional feature that was made exactly like the headboard of the palang.
